Hi All, Here's something called Diary Of Mercer Street. Everybody’s moving this summer to a red brick building on Houston Street Like an empty downtown cousin standing on the corner keeping the beat No windows or window panes to be seen Rats like cats and a couple of old Village Queens That was Mercer Street in 1965 Yeah, sounds like Mercer Street in '65 Everybody’s shouting in spanish as they drill the sidewalks in the summer heat For a couple of hundred a month was a basement space in this Soho suite Now Fanelli tosses the drunks out every night A bodega on Prince Street yeah that's where you go for a bite That was Mercer Street in 1965 Yeah, sounds like Mercer Street in '65 Everybody’s painting on the sidewalk like an artist with a brush and some chalk No galleries or café scenes to be found so you got to hang and gawk Colors drip on the canvas hard and mean And dusk dusk builds a halo round her Afro Sheen That was Mercer Street in 1965 Sounds like Mercer Street in '65 Everybody’s quiet at night but the guy with no shoes in the cardboard box And the rambling gutter talk of the junkies in the shadows on the block Between folkies and the new real estate pawns And all the subway girls blowing north after dawn That was Mercer Street in 1965 Yeah, sounds like Mercer Street in '65 BIAB Tracks: 995: Bass, Electric, 8thsPumpin Ev 150 2194: Piano, ElectricVintage, Rhythm Ev 085 3720: Guitar, Baritone Acoustic Rhythm Ev 150 3332: Guitar, Electric, Rhythm, GrittyRockFusion Ev 130 2534: Guitar, 12-String Acoustic, HeldChords RealDrums: Rock^01-a:Closed Hat, Snare, b:Open Hat, Snare As always - thanks for listening! Bob
